Judson’s Demoss Center to Host GreenRoom Improv and Documentary Premiere

The Demoss Center for Worship in the Performing Arts (DCWPA) will host a Green Room Improv performance and premiere the documentary Finding Light in the Dark Room at 7 p.m. on Saturday, August 28, in Herrick Chapel (1151 N. State Street). 

The evening event will include laughter and reflection as it features GreenRoom Improv and a special DCWPA documentary film highlighting the songwriting-to-recording journey of several DCWPA students for this year’s Dark Room project. Both events were planned for last spring but were postponed until the start of the 2021-22 academic year.

GreenRoom was founded by a group of Judson University students in 1999. Since then, GreenRoom has performed nationally for a wide range of audiences and events. They currently have residencies in two theaters: The Hemmens Cultural Center in Elgin, Ill., and The Raue Center For the Arts in Crystal Lake, Ill., where they perform monthly.

The event is free and open to the public.
